What to expect: 
The course will be big bike friendly and beginner friendly. The dirt sections will be typical Hill Country dirt roads, mostly class 1 and 2 with numerous low water crossings. You should be comfortable riding off-pavement and ready for two long days in the saddle. We will be riding public paved and unpaved roads – there is no off-road or single-track riding. This is not a race or a timed event, but it will be fun for veteran riders and rookies alike!

Organization:

We will divide into small riding groups (Ideally 6 or fewer). Recruit some friends and create your own group, or show up at the riders meeting Thursday and we will help groups get together. You will meet people and make new friends!


Preparation:

Your bike should be in good working order and have at least a 130 mile fuel range. You should have all the necessary tools with you to repair a flat (the single most common problem during an adventure ride) or handle typical problems with your particular motorcycle. Please don't rely on others to have the tools and parts to fix your bike in the event it breaks.


Gear:

Everyone participating is operating at their own risk, and expected to wear full safety gear: Helmets, motorcycle jackets/pants, boots, gloves etc. at a minimum. Hydration packs are also encouraged.


Navigation & Communication:

GPX files will be provided. This event is a self-guided tour. You should be familiar with navigation via GPS devices/apps. If you are not, we can pair you with other riders who are. Comms units are encouraged. Most riders will use Sena or Cardo.
